Regulator of calcineurin 1 (RCAN1) binds to calcineurin through the PxIxIT motif, which is evolutionarily conserved. SP repeat phosphorylation in RCAN1 is required for its complete function. The specific interaction between RCAN1 and calcineurin is critical for calcium/calmodulin-dependent regulation of calcineurin serine/threonine phosphatase activity. In this study, we investigated two available deletion rcan-1 mutants in Caenorhabditis elegans, which proceed differently for transcription and translation. We found that rcan-1 may be required for calcineurin activity and possess calcineurin-independent function in body growth and egg-laying behavior. In the genetic background of enhanced calcineurin activity, the rcan-1 mutant expressing a truncated RCAN-1 which retains the calcineurin-binding PxIxIT motif but misses SP repeats stimulated growth, while rcan-1 lack mutant resulted in hyperactive egg-laying suppression. These data suggest rcan-1 has unknown functions independent of calcineurin, and may be a stimulatory calcineurin regulator under certain circumstances.

Thioredoxin reductase (TrxR) is a member of the pyridine nucleotide-disulfide reductase family, which mainly func-tions in the thioredoxin system. TrxR is found in all living organisms and exists in two major ubiquitous isoen-zymes in higher eukaryotic cells; One is cytosolic and the other mitochondrial. Mitochondrial TrxR functions to protect mitochondria from oxidative stress, where reactive oxidative species are mainly generated, while cytosolic TrxR plays a role to maintain optimal oxido-reductive status in cytosol. In this study, we report differential physiological functions of these two TrxRs in C. elegans. trxr-1, the cytosolic TrxR, is highly expressed in pharynx, vulva and intestine, whereas trxr-2, the mitochondrial TrxR, is mainly expressed in pharyngeal and body wall muscles. Deficiency of the non-selenoprotein trxr-2 caused defects in longevity and delayed development under stress conditions, while deletion mutation of the selenoprotein trxr-1 resulted in interference in acidification of lysosomal compartment in intestine. Interestingly, the acidification defect of trxr-1(jh143) deletion mutant was rescued, not only by selenocystein-containing wild type TRXR-1, but also cysteine-substituted mutant TRXR-1. Both trxr-1 and trxr-2 were up-regulated when worms were challenged by environmental stress such as heat shock. These results suggest that trxr-1 and trxr-2 function differently at organismal level presumably by their differential sub-cellular localization in C. elegans.
Time-varying Group Formation With Leader-following Control for Heterogeneous Multi-agent Systems

This paper studies time-varying group formation control for heterogeneous multi-agent systems (MAS). Two subgroups of heterogeneous MAS consisting of second-order dynamic and Euler-Lagrange (E-L) dynamic agents, three subgroups of heterogeneous MAS consisting of first-order, second-order dynamic and E-L dynamic agents are considered respectively. Firstly, through the assumption of the formation-tracking feasibility condition and the design of the formation compensation vectors in the controller, the time-varying formation control can be transformed into a consensus problem. Then, a distributed controller based on neighbor information is designed and sufficient conditions for time-varying formation control are obtained. The time-varying group formation problem of heterogeneous MAS is analyzed by Lyapunov stability theory and eigenvalue theory. Finally, two simulation results show that the proposed controller can realize the time-varying formation control of heterogeneous group MAS.
